I was driving back from Jebel Shams this past weekend and was stopped at the checkpoint reentering the UAE.

The customs officer stopped me and asked me to step outside, then went directly to the center console where I keep my GPS and walkie talkies. He handed them over to his boss who told me that I had 6 months to pick it up from the border once I got some approval from some telecoms authority in the Khalidia area of Abu Dhabi.

They were polite and nice about it. He didn't ask me why I had them, but he checked the serial numbers on them and I suppose possibly registered them with me or something.

Does anyone know if this is a major concern? I'm just trying to determine whether going back for those walkie talkies is risky or not. Has anyone experienced something like this?

No it happen with me once before. I got a device from Canada in which was confiscated,, I went to TRA. At 1st they refused then agreed on charges of 1200 for device (A+B ). I refused,,
You don't need a license. As far as you put it away as soon as you are out of Sand,,
